Lionel Messi reveals his surprise pick to win the Ballon d'Or and claims he 'deserves it more than anyone'

Lionel Messi revealed his surprise pick to win the Ballon d’Or.

Lionel Messi revealed his surprise pick to win the Ballon d’Or.

On Tuesday Messi scored his 10 international hat-trick as Argentina dismantled Bolivia 6-0 in World Cup qualifying.

In turn, the 37-year-old, who also provided two assists for his team-mates, moved level with Cristiano Ronaldo for the player with the most hat-tricks in men’s international football.

Speaking to TYC Sports after the game, Messi, who has a record eight Ballon d’Ors, claimed that international team-mate Lautaro Martinez deserves to win this year’s iteration of the award.

Messi said: “Lautaro deserves the Ballon D’Or more than anyone. He had a spectacular year, he scored a goal in the [Copa America] final, he was the top scorer in Copa America.”

Meanwhile, Martinez, who netted 24 times and registered six assists in 33 appearances in last year’s Serie A, added that he believed he should be in contention for the Ballon d’Or this year.

He said: “I don’t know if I deserve to win the Ballon D’Or but after the spectacular year I had I deserve to be up there”

Elsewhere, Messi acknowledged that his international career was approaching its end, when he refused to say whether he would play in the 2026 World Cup.

“I didn’t set any date or deadline about my future,” Messi said. “I’m just enjoying all this. I am more emotional than ever and taking all the love from the people because I know these can be my last games.”

Messi added: “It’s a joy to be present and appreciate this moment. Being surrounded by younger teammates, given my age, makes me feel like a kid again.

“I find myself doing silly things because I feel so comfortable. As long as I maintain that feeling and can continue contributing to the team, I plan to be here enjoying [the national team].”
